Reb Simcha Bunim portrayed himself as an ordinary man during the years before he became Rebbe. We now have many stories that demonstrate his hidden greatness as an "ordinary man." Reb Simcha Bunim worked as a lumber merchant. When Reb Simcha Bunim traveled to fairs, his main goal was to help Jews and to daven (pray) for them. Interesting stories are told about the merchants’ attempt to drag Reb Simcha Bunim to the theater.
